Please let me educate you

Originally Posted by opus_opus
"Poor Man's Porsche" came out not because of Boxster's lack of handling capability. Rather, those who buys it usually can't afford the 911s
It's an ignorant perception that comes out of envy. The Boxster is not a baby 911. Did any of you know that? Boxster is a completely different platform, mid-engine 2-seat, roadster, yet shares most of the parts of the 911. It is an ALTERNATIVE to 911 that IMO is a better one. The only advantage of 911 is power, but not by much. But Boxster is better handling to make up for it. The quality, fit & finish & materials are EXACTLY the same. The cost is $25K less when you compare Boxster S with Carerra base cab, giving up only 30HP which can be easily made up with exhaust upgrade. The Carerra S cab tops $100K when loaded. Ouch!

I can easily purchase Carerra cab, but guess what? The darn clutch is much heavier and it feels bigger and not as tossable like the Boxster. To me a sports car should be nimble and light, so yes, to me the Boxster is a better sports car than 911. I didn't say faster, but better, i.e. more fun. To each his own.

The only reason I would get 911 is more prestige. But isn't that way of thinking for *******? I think that explains the wrong perception you are talking about. It comes from the *******.

It's sad when people are ignorant, but that is their loss.
